- Applying generative AI techniques to support data extraction, ingestion, and harmonisation from diverse geological and relational data sources.
- Exploring frontier AI technologies and contributing to prototypes using approaches such as RAG or graph-based retrieval systems.
- Develop robust Python pipelines for data manipulation using NLP and Foundation Models
- Apply geospatial libraries and techniques to subsurface geological datasets
- Implement secure coding practices and manage version control using Git
- Optimize database performance and spatial queries using PostgreSQL/PostGIS
